Transaction Code: BD86
Description: Consistency check for sales
Release: S/4HANA and ECC 6
Program: RBDCUS26
Screen: 0
Authorization Object:
Development Package: DALE
Package Description: ALE Application
Parent Package: APPL
Module/Component: CA-BFA-ABL
Description: ALE Business Process Library
